Wireless multicast for cloud radio access network with heterogeneous backhaul

Cooperative communication in which multiple base-stations (BSs) jointly transmit to mobile users is a major advantage of the cloud radio-access network (C-RAN) architecture. This paper considers the use of wireless multicast for sharing user messages at multiple BSs in the C-RAN backhaul for cooperation purpose. To combat fading and path-loss in the wireless channels to the different BSs, this paper proposes the optimal provisioning of secondary backhaul to smooth out the channel disparity. The paper analyzes the problem structure and proposes an efficient algorithm for the optimization of secondary backhaul rate provisioning.
